If you want to be a part of this journey, then this role is for you. About the Role We are looking for an experienced accountant to join our team based in Otago. This role reports to the CFO and will work alongside three others in the team, with payroll and accounts being direct reports. This role includes usual accounting functions but there are a couple of exciting projects in the pipeline that will offer opportunities for development. These include the replacement of the payroll and finance systems, as well as a move towards using Power BI for financial and non-financial reporting. This role will suit someone who is looking for variety and likes to improve processes and systems.
